African Business, in a June 12 piece produced with CBN support, said the bank had inherited a backlog of more than $7 billion in matured FX obligations in 2023, and now points to reserves above $50 billion, more than 10 months of import cover, inflation easing to about 15%, and the gap between official and parallel exchange rates shrinking from 60% to about 2%. On June 10, 2026, Cardoso accepted the award in London; on June 11, Premium Times reported the ceremony and highlighted his message to CBN staff; by June 12, Punch and African Business had expanded the narrative to focus on forex reform, FATF grey-list removal, recapitalisation, and the macro numbers being cited as evidence of turnaround.

The twist that makes the story stand out is that what looks like a ceremonial honour is actually being used as a referendum on the CBN’s broader reset after the 2023 crisis period. Yemi Cardoso’s biggest new win this week is that Nigeria’s central bank has now turned a March 2026 industry award into a far more politically potent June story, with fresh reporting framing the London ceremony on June 10-11 as international validation of the CBN’s most controversial reforms: FX-market liberalisation, anti-inflation tightening, and a clean break from past monetary financing.

” The awards body first named the CBN “Central bank of the year” on March 17, 2026, but the story surged again after Cardoso physically received the honour in London on Wednesday, June 10, with Nigerian outlets reporting it on June 11 and June 12. “The award was not a personal achievement but a testament to the collective efforts of the CBN,” Premium Times reported him saying on June 11.

African Business describes the backdrop as “severe macroeconomic distortions,” including depleted reserves, a wide FX spread and the $7 billion-plus obligations overhang, making the award a symbolic reversal of narrative for an institution that had been under intense scrutiny. Central Banking itself was more cautious on precise figures but confirmed the same arc: “billions of dollars” in obligations were cleared, unencumbered FX reserves were rebuilt, and inflation was declining.
